Abstract:
:The aim of this article is to present the course of the condition in a case of congenital temporomandibular joint ankylosis that caused facial disfigurement, significant reduction of mouth opening, difficulty in feeding and breathing, and general interference with physical development.

abstract::Malacoplakia is a rare inflammatory condition characterized by demonstrative Michaelis-Gutmann bodies, which are foamy histiocytes with distinctive basophilic inclusions. Malacoplakia is caused by the inadequate elimination of bacteria by macrophages or monocytes as a result of defective phagocytic activity. Xanthogra...
